HEALTHY GREEK YOGURT PUMPKIN MUFFINS



Healthy Greek Yogurt Pumpkin Muffins image

Greek yogurt pumpkin muffins are delicious and healthy from the easy ingredient swaps!

Provided by Marjory Pilley

Categories     Breakfast     Snack

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 1/2 cup white whole wheat flour (any wheat flour will work)
1/2 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
15 ounce pumpkin puree (2 cups with 2 Tablespoons removed)
1 egg
5.3 ounce Greek yogurt (1/2 cup)
1/2 cup Mini chocolate chips, semi-sweet (or raisins)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Combine fl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t and cinnamon in a bowl.
  • Stir pumpkin, egg and yogurt into the dry mix.
  • Fold in mini chocolate chips.
  • Fill muffins tin wells coated with cooking spray about 2/3 full (about 1/4 cup of batter.) Tip: if using liners, give them a light spritz of cooking spray too.
  • Bake for 20-25 minute or until the muffins are firm and lightly browned on the top.
  • Allow muffins to cool for 5 minutes in the pan and then remove to a wire rack to cool further. Enjoy!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 164 kcal, Carbohydrate 27 g, Protein 5 g, Fat 5 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, Cholesterol 15 mg, Sodium 155 mg, Fiber 3 g, Sugar 14 g, ServingSize 1 serving

WHOLE FOODS WHOLE WHEAT PUMPKIN MUFFINS



Whole Foods Whole Wheat Pumpkin Muffins image

Very yummy muffins courtesy of the can label off of the 365 canned pumpkin. I even substituted egg beaters for the egg, splenda for the sugar and applesauce for the butter and they are still great.

Provided by londongavchick

Categories     Quick Breads

Time 35m

Yield 12 muffins, 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up all-purpose flour
3/4 cup whole wheat flour
3 tablespoons sugar (or splenda)
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 beaten egg (or egg substitute)
3/4 cup skim milk
2 tablespoons butter, melted (or applesauce)
1/2 cup canned pumpkin
cooking spray

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
  • Spray 12 2-1/2 inch muffin cups with nonstick cooking spray. Dust with flour and set asie.
  • In a large bowl, stir together dry ingredients and make a well in center of flour mixture.
  • In a small bowl, combine egg, milk and butter and then stir in pumpkin.
  • Add pumpkin mixture all at once to flour mixture and stir until just moistened (batter should be lumpy).
  • Spoon batter into prepared muffin cups, filling about 2/3 full.
  • Bake for 15 to 18 minutes or until a wooden toothpick inserted in centers comes out clean. Cool in pan on a wire rack for 5 minutes. Remove from muffin cups. Serve warm.

WHOLE WHEAT PUMPKIN-YOGURT MUFFINS



Whole Wheat Pumpkin-Yogurt Muffins image

These light, moist muffins are packed with fall flavors. Fill your muffin cups almost to the top for beautifully puffed muffins.

Time 45m

Yield Makes 12

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 3/4 cup whole wheat pastry flour
1/4 cup flaxseed meal
2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on fine sea salt
2 large eggs
1 cup pumpkin purée
1 (6.0-ounce) container nonfat plain Greek yogurt
1/2 cup brown sugar
3 tablespoons molasses
3 tablespoons canola oil
2 tablespoons green pumpkin seeds (also known as pepitas)
1 tablespoon sesame seeds

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F and line a 12-cup muffin pan with paper liners.
  • In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, flaxseed meal, baking powder, baking soda, pumpkin pie spice and salt.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together eggs, pumpkin, yogurt, brown sugar, molasses and oil.
  • Stir flour mixture into pumpkin mixture just until combined.
  • Spoon batter into muffin cups, filling each almost full.
  • Sprinkle tops with pumpkin seeds and sesame seeds.
  • Bake until tops are browned and a toothpick inserted into the center of each muffin comes out with just a few moist crumbs clinging to it, about 25 minutes.
  • Cool in the pan for 10 minutes and serve, or transfer to a wire rack to cook completely and store in an airtight container up to 2 days.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 190 calories, Fat 7 grams, SaturatedFat 1 grams, Cholesterol 30 milligrams, Sodium 230 milligrams, Carbohydrate 28 grams, Protein 6 grams

PUMPKIN MUFFINS WITH GREEK YOGURT



Pumpkin Muffins with Greek Yogurt image

I took the base of this recipe from a recipe for chocolate muffins that I found on Pinterest. With oats, nonfat Greek yogurt, and pumpkin at the core, these muffins are both wholesome and delicious!

Provided by chosenbygrace

Categories     Bread     Quick Bread Recipes     Pumpkin Bread Recipes

Time 30m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 cups rolled oats
1 (15 ounce) can pumpkin puree
1 cup nonfat plain Greek yogurt
¾ cup stevia powder
¼ cup whole wheat flour
¼ cup brown sugar
¼ cup hot water
3 egg whites
1 ½ tablespoons ground cinnamon
1 tablespoon white vinegar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 teaspoon ground cloves
½ teaspoon ground nutmeg
½ te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line a 12-cup muffin tin with paper liners.
  • Combine oats, pumpkin, yogurt, stevia, whole wheat flour, brown sugar, water, egg whites, cinnamon, vinegar, vanilla extract, cloves, nutmeg, and salt in a food processor or blender. Blend until smooth, with only small pieces of oats left. Pour into the prepared muffin cups.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center of a muffin comes out clean, 15 to 20 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 120.7 calories, Carbohydrate 29.9 g, Cholesterol 1.1 mg, Fat 1.1 g, Fiber 3.2 g, Protein 5 g, SaturatedFat 0.2 g, Sodium 207.9 mg, Sugar 7.7 g

FRUITY WHOLE WHEAT YOGURT MUFFINS



Fruity Whole Wheat Yogurt Muffins image

These are very moist muffins. You can match the type of yogurt to the type of fruit you are using if you want to improve the flavour.

Provided by Manuela

Categories     Quick Breads

Time 35m

Yield 12 muffins, 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up whole wheat flour
1/2 cup white sugar
3 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1 (8 ounce) container plain yogurt
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
4 tablespoons oil
2 cups finely cubed apples (or any other fruit)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Grease 12 muffin cups or line with paper muffin liners.
  • Stir together flour, sugar, baking soda and baking powder.
  • In a separate bowl, combine yogurt, egg, vanilla, oil and fruit.
  • Stir mixtures together just until combined; batter will be very thick.
  • Scoop into prepared muffin cups and bake in preheated oven for 25 minutes.
  • Tip: I use to beat egg together with a little of the sugar until fluffy and light in colour.
  • This helps the leavening process.
